Criminal Justice and Corrections is a Master offered by St. John's University-New York in Queens, NY. Graduates earn a median of $57,106 early in their careers, rising to $78,510 with experience. Tuition is $53,020 — first-year median earnings are about 1.1× the annual tuition. St. John's University-New York admits 83% of applicants and enrolls about 9,477 students.
